Combinations
A combination is an arrangement from a set of n items taken r items at a time, where ordering does not matter. The number of possible combinations is
c(n, r) = n!/(r!(n - r)!) = n!/(r!d!)
If d = n - r = 0, then c(n, r) = n!/r! = n!/n! = 1. - Permutations
A permutation is an arrangement from a set of n items taken r items at a time, where ordering does matter. The number of possible permutations is
p(n, r) = n!/(n - r)! = n!/d!
If d = n - r = 0, then p(n, r) = n!. - Circulations
A circulation or circular permutation is a circular arrangement from a set of n items taken r items at a time, where relative ordering does matter. The number of possible circulations is
cp(n, r) = n!/(r(n - r)!) = n!/(r(d!))
If d = n - r = 0, then cp(n, r) = n!/r = n!/n. - Inversions
An inversion is a permutation in which the relative order of two items is contrary to that of a reference permutation.- The maximum number of inversions in a permutation is
imaximum = n(n - 1)/2
and computed for d = n - r = 0. - The total number of inversions in a set of permutations is
itotal = (n(n - 1)/4)n!
and computed for d = n - r = 0.

- Five-place numbers are to be formed by using the digits 1 to 8, inclusive, with the digits sorted in descending order. How many of such numbers can be formed?
- How many permutations can be formed by the first 7 letters of the alphabet taken 3 at a time?
- A group consists of 6 individuals. Four individuals will be selected at random and seated at a round table. How many seating arrangements are possible if the relative order of the individuals matters?
- If abcdefg is a reference sequence, how many inversions are in the sequence cadbfge and why?
- JUNE consists of four letters. These are painted on four marbles, one on each marble. How many pairs of letters can be formed?
- How many straight lines are required to equally interconnect six points (nodes) distributed on a graph?
- How many primary connections are required to equally interconnect 4 Linkedin users?
- A batch of 50 articles contains 5 defective articles. A quality control (QC) tranfer scientist inspects this batch by taking 3 articles at random. What is the probability that the selected articles are not defective?
- A batch of 100 manufactured chemical samples is checked by a QC chemistry inspector, who examines 10 chemical samples selected at random. If none of the 10 chemical samples is defective, he accepts the whole batch. Otherwise, the batch is subjected to further inspection. What is the probability that a batch containing 10 defective chemical samples will be accepted?
- How many edges are in polyhedral crystals consisting of n = 4, n = 6 and n = 8 vertices?
- How many microstates are possible for the valence electrons in the outermost orbitals of carbon?
- Three cards are drawn at random from a full deck. What is the probability of getting a three, a seven and an ace?
- What is the probability of being able to form a triangle from three segments chosen at random from five line segments of lengths 1, 3, 5, 7 and 9? Hint. A triangle cannot be formed if one segment is longer than the sum of the other two.
